Dry mouth is brought on by an absence of saliva, which assists avoid tooth decay by getting rid of food and plaque from your teeth. Materials discovered in saliva also assist counter the acid generated by bacteria. These minerals, specifically hydroxyapatite, will certainly become soluble when subjected to acidic environments. Dentin and also cementum are a lot more at risk to decays than enamel since they have lower mineral content. Thus, when root surface areas of teeth are revealed from gingival recession or periodontal illness, decays can develop more readily. Even in a healthy and balanced dental setting, however, the tooth is susceptible to tooth decays. Microorganisms in a person's mouth transform glucose, fructose, as well as a lot of typically sucrose right into acids such as lactic acid through a glycolytic process called fermentation. If left in contact with the tooth, these acids might cause demineralization, which is the dissolution of its mineral web content. Softer than enamel, it's a lot more sensitive to acid damage. Avoid a diet plan high in sugar in addition to eating in between meals. Tooth cavities frequently impact children whose diet is rich in sugary foods and sugar. Sugar itself does not trigger dental caries - the decay creates when bacteria in the mouth damage down sugars to create acid, which demineralizes the hard tissues of the teeth. Excess sugar can lead not just to dental cavity but likewise to periodontal illness and can even trigger missing teeth. In the really onset of dental caries, fluoride treatments can repair broken enamel-- a process called remineralization. You can get an appropriate quantity of fluoride by drinking fluoridated water, which can be located in tap water. You ought to additionally comb your teeth with fluoride tooth paste. The majority of bottled water does not have enough fluoride to help with avoiding dental caries. A dental expert may recommend using a fluoride gel or varnish, suggest fluoride tablet computers, or advise fluoride mouthwash if they believe you require to enhance your consumption.
